Responsibilities
- Design and implement novel quantum algorithms for optimization problems
- Lead experimental validation of quantum protocols on superconducting qubit systems
- Develop error-correction frameworks for fault-tolerant quantum computing
- Collaborate with hardware teams to co-design quantum processor architectures
- Publish groundbreaking research in top-tier journals and conferences
- Mentor junior researchers and drive cross-functional innovation initiatives
Qualifications
- PhD in Quantum Physics, Computer Science, or related field
- 3+ years of hands-on quantum algorithm development experience
- Proficiency in quantum programming frameworks (Qiskit, Cirq, or Q#)
- Publication record in Nature/Science or equivalent quantum computing venues
- Deep understanding of quantum error correction and fault tolerance
- Experience with cryogenic quantum hardware systems
- Strong background in linear algebra and computational complexity theory
